WebRayon, including viscose, Tencel, and modal, are some of the most popular tree-based fabrics in the market. The process to turn trees into fabric generally involves making a wood pulp. The pulp is washed and treated to create regenerated cellulose fibres that are then manufactured into a textile. WebFacts is a voluntary set of guidelines and assesses a range of environmental issues specific to textile manufacturing practices including: fiber sourcing, safety of materials, water conservation and water quality, energy, recycling practices, air quality in manufacturing, and social accountability. WebFacts certification recognizes contract textiles that conform to and are third-party certified under the multi-attribute standard, Association for Contract Textiles NSF/ANSI 336.
